Bozdari Expedition
Part of North West Frontier Campaigns
Date: 5-21 March 1857
Location: Bozdari Territory, NWF
Presidency: Bengal
Co-ordinates: approx 30.691806°N 70.517304°E
Result: Submission of tribes
Combatants
East India Company Bozdari tribesmen
Commanders
Brig Gen N Chamberlain
Strength
Casualties

For the 1853 Battle of Bozdari Territory, see Shirani Expedition 1853.

The Bozdari Expedition of 1857, also known as the Battle of Bozdari Territory.
